FOX Sports’ lead college football analyst Joel Klatt shares his way-too-early top 10 rankings ahead of the 2023 season. Georgia is at the top coming off back-to-back national championships, followed by Michigan, Ohio State, and Alabama in his tier one of the top ten. Joel also shares the seven teams he left off the top ten but were close. Then, Joel breaks down the four teams he believes will climb the most next season and improve their record by at least four wins.

Found it interesting that the argument used for OU bouncing back in a big way (all but 2 losses were close, recruiting is doing well, qb coming back) were forgotten about wrt Texas. All 5 of Texas losses were one possession scores. Texas beat OU 49-0. Gabriel doesn’t make that much of a difference. UT returns 10 offensive starters including the entire offensive line plus 3 more OL that saw significant snaps. Ewers should mature/improve significantly. Defense was great by the end of the year and should continue to improve with the additions. Finally, UT has recruited even better than OU has both of the last two years. I think it was more of an overlook than a slight by Joel, but UT is coming on strong next year.
